Structure and vision of the Faber Energy Group
With over 200+ employees at three locations in Germany, the Group pursues a clear vision: to create a stable and sustainable energy supply. The professional fields of activity are spread across our specialised subsidiaries:
Faber E-Tec: Focus on the planning and production of transformer stations and the expansion of the grid connection infrastructure.
Faber Solar TechnologySpecialised in the planning and construction of large-scale solar parks and commercial PV systems.
Faber Energy TradingStrategic area for modern energy trading and the marketing of green electricity.

Career FAQs: Frequently asked questions about your application
The Faber Energy Group is committed to an efficient and transparent recruitment process. Here applicants will find clear answers about the processes at our subsidiaries Faber E-Tec, Faber Solar Technology and Faber Energy Trading.
1. which documents should I enclose with my application?
Your name, e-mail address and telephone number are all you need to contact the Faber Energy Group for the first time. A CV or references can optionally be uploaded, but are not a strict requirement for the initial contact. The focus is on getting to know each other personally.
2. are multiple applications for different positions possible?
Yes, but an explicit multiple application is not necessary. In the first interview, we will evaluate together whether your qualifications are better suited to the medium-voltage sector (E-Tec), photovoltaic project planning (solar technology) or energy trading (Trading).
3. are unsolicited applications welcome at the Faber Energy Group?
Unsolicited applications are expressly encouraged. If none of the current vacancies are suitable, applicants can submit their documents stating the desired specialism (e.g. construction of transformer stations or project assistance).
4. how is the application process defined?
The Faber Energy Group's process is divided into four phases:
Incoming check: Prompt examination of the documents.
Initial contact: Initial telephone or digital meeting.
Get to know each other personally: On site at the Bünde or Dresden location.
Integration: Depending on the position, there will be a trial period or an introduction to the future team.
5. how long does it take to respond to an application?
The control response time of the Faber Energy Group is maximum 7 days after receipt of the application.
6. does the Group offer jobs for career changers?
Yes, the Faber Energy Group encourages lateral entry, particularly in the areas of solar park installation, technical project assistance and general energy services. The decisive factors are a willingness to learn and an interest in energy infrastructure.
7. where are the operational sites located?
The Faber Energy Group is present at the following locations:
Bünde (North Rhine-Westphalia): Head office, administration and production plant for compact transformer stations.
Dresden (Saxony): Competence centre for sales and project planning.
Nationwide: Energy projects are realised directly on site at the customer's premises throughout Germany.
